概括
使用血清生物标志物可以改善1型麻醉症 (NT1) 诊断. 这项研究确定了NT1患者的关键代谢途径和特定代谢物,为新的诊断工具提供了潜力.

主要成果:
- 在NT1患者中鉴定出453种不同丰富的血清代谢物.
- 关键的激活途径包括炎症,活性氧物种和神经元细胞死亡.
- 验证了49种代谢物,注意到尿素,上腺素,p-cresol硫酸盐和氨酸的显著变化.

Sleep apnea is a condition where breathing stops intermittently during sleep, often leading to significant health issues. Each episode can last from 10 to 20 seconds or more and is frequently accompanied by a brief arousal from sleep. This disturbance, largely unnoticed by the individual, can lead to severe daytime fatigue. Commonly, individuals seek help after being informed by their partners about loud snoring and noticeable breathing pauses during sleep.
